About Petite-Île
Petite-Île is a town located in Réunion, in the Reunion region. With a recorded population of 12,617, it is home to a diverse community of residents.
Geographically, Petite-Île lies at coordinates 21.35°S, 55.56°E, placing it in the Southern Eastern Hemisphere. The city operates on the Indian/Reunion timezone, which governs daily life and business hours for its inhabitants.
